First-day checklist — Secure interview room

☐ Locate Room 2.08, the secure interview room at Fenwick Row. You may be asked to escort candidates there during your first week. The door locks automatically, so never leave a candidate inside alone. If your badge has not been activated yet, use the keypad code below.

staff pass of kawip-hawef = bdg-QLP-2

Ticket VLT-providing context for Thursday's eng sync: the Harrowfield secrets vault locked itself after three failed unseal attempts during the Dispatchly driver-assignment heuristic deploy. The heuristic's config bundle, including the new proximity weights, is inaccessible until we unseal. Root cause appears to be a stale unseal script referencing the retired quorum. Proposed fix: rotate the quorum shares and re-run the deploy. To unseal manually before the sync, operators should use the recovery passphrase below.

unlock words, tawif-tahop: oliys-ulawyn-tamdor-lamys-casox-jormir-fraius-kasath-ulador-ulamir-holir-sorys-holeth

Subject: Handover — Lattice API pagination rollout

Hey Priya,

Quick handover before the sync: cursor-based pagination for the Lattice public REST API goes out Thursday. Offset params stay supported for two releases, then 410. Docs are updated; the deprecation banner is live in the dev portal. One gotcha: the cursor format changed in rc3, so re-run the contract tests. Release artifacts should be signed with the key below.

rollout seal: bky19_GLHMhzUtYPr4jkbQawL

## Deployment: Connection Pooling

Heads up, on-call folks: Spindlewick keeps a per-pod connection pool against the Ledgerbarn database, and it's the first thing to check when you see timeout spikes. Pool exhaustion usually means a slow query hogging connections, not a network issue, so grab the slow-query log before restarting anything. Scaling pods without raising the database's max connections will just move the bottleneck. The pool ships with these defaults in production.

settings of yageg-yahap:
[gorael]
team = olieth
access_code = ac_941d74
owner = brieth.aldiel
host = gorael.tolvaqio.internal
port = 6379
peer = briwyn.urlaqtech.internal
salt = 116e6622
pin = 1957